Industry Leader Jamie Brabston Strengthens Maynard Nexsen's National Government Solutions Platform
Former Counsel for Redstone Consulting Joins Firm in Huntsville
Maynard Nexsen is pleased to announce that Jamie Brabston has joined the firm as a Shareholder in its nationally recognized Government Solutions Group, further strengthening the firm's capabilities in government contracts, compliance, and employment-related matters.
Brabston brings more than three decades of experience advising federal contractors and employers on complex regulatory and workplace issues. Widely recognized for her deep industry knowledge, practical counsel, and longstanding relationships within the government contracting community, she draws on her unique background as both a government consultant and attorney to help clients navigate evolving regulatory requirements and manage risk.
Based in the firm's Huntsville office, Brabston advises clients on government contracts compliance, employment law, workplace investigations, and labor-related matters. She works closely with federal contractors to address complex compliance obligations and regularly conducts mock compliance assessments to help organizations prepare for audits, investigations, and agency reviews.

A trusted advisor to government contractors and employers alike, Brabston counsels clients on compliance, risk mitigation, and the resolution of complex employment and contract-related issues. She has extensive experience responding to agency complaints and investigations involving the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C), U.S. Department of Labor, including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) issues and prevailing wage and benefits issues arising under the Service Contract Act (SCA) and the Davis-Bacon Act (DBA).
Prior to joining Maynard Nexsen, Brabston served as Director and Legal Counsel for Redstone Government Consulting, where she advised government contractors on labor and employment matters, compliance obligations, and workplace challenges. In that role, she became a well-known and highly regarded resource within the contractor community, helping organizations navigate increasingly complex regulatory and contractual landscapes.
Her previous experience also includes serving as senior counsel at a boutique labor and employment law firm in Alabama and as a shareholder at a Huntsville-based law firm. This combination of private practice and government consulting experience allows her to provide clients with practical, strategic guidance grounded in a deep understanding of both legal and operational realities.

In addition to her legal practice, Brabston is a recognized thought leader and frequent speaker on government contracting issues. She serves as a trainer and presenter for Federal Publications Seminars' Government Contract Oversight – Audits, Reviews and Investigations, and regularly speaks on employment law and compliance topics, including nondiscrimination, anti-harassment, leadership development, and federal contractor obligations.
Brabston earned her J.D. from the University of Alabama School of Law, where she was a member of the International Moot Court Team, Order of the Barristers, and contributed to the Law & Psychology Review. She earned her B.A. from the University of Alabama.
